Sentencing advocacy involves legal representation focused on influencing the length and terms of a sentence following a criminal conviction. The advocate prepares detailed submissions and arguments that emphasize mitigating factors, character evidence, and lawful considerations to seek leniency or alternative sentencing options. This form of advocacy aims to ensure that the court’s punishment fits the individual circumstances fairly.
Effective sentencing advocacy includes thorough case review, gathering supporting evidence, and crafting persuasive arguments for the court. The process often involves collaboration with clients to understand their backgrounds and goals. Attorneys may negotiate with prosecutors and present sentencing memoranda to judges, all aimed at achieving the most favorable sentencing outcome possible.
Understanding legal terminology is crucial for clients navigating sentencing advocacy. Below are definitions of common terms to help clarify this process.
Circumstances or information presented to reduce the severity or culpability in a case, potentially leading to lighter sentencing.
A written document submitted by attorneys to the court outlining arguments for leniency or alternative sentencing based on facts and mitigating evidence.
An agreement between the defendant and prosecutor where the defendant pleads guilty to a charge in exchange for concessions on sentencing or charges.
A court-ordered period of supervised release instead of or in addition to incarceration, often with specific conditions to be followed by the offender.

Yes, sentences can sometimes be appealed on legal grounds such as procedural errors or disproportionate penalties. Appeals must be filed within strict time limits, and having knowledgeable legal support is vital to navigate this process successfully. Violations of probation can lead to revocation and imposition of original sentences. Sentencing advocates help by representing clients in hearings related to violations, presenting justifications, and negotiating alternatives to incarceration.
